The first crucial question is: “Who uses this product?” The second, and perhaps most critical question is: “Why will they buy this product?”
Answer these two questions and establish the foundation for identifying your Ideal Customer Profile (ICP).
You don’t just write content — you write targeted content that speaks directly to your audience.
When it comes to making purchasing decisions, customers are motivated by four key factors:
-Status: Does this product enhance their image or prestige
-Efficiency: Is it easy to use and does it deliver great results quickly
-Emotions: Does it evoke feelings of necessity, joy, or satisfaction?
-Price: — The age-old factor — how affordable is it compared to alternatives?
Understanding who your brand serves best allows you to tailor content that resonates deeply with your audience’s needs, desires, and behaviors.
